Whilst strolling around the pretty Somerset town of Langport on the hunt for a tranquil place to stop for a bit to eat, I recently stumbled across the new Art, Tea, Zen Café, a very stylish and modern new establishment on the High Street. The interior decoration is very bright and funky and there are several giant cupcake prints hung on the walls. The café has an abundance of chilled seating areas and very posh glossy magazines and books to browse through whilst you are waiting for your lunch. The food was sensational. There is a wide variety of reasonable priced snacks and cakes on offer and the café stocks the largest variety of tea and coffee I have ever experienced. I thorough recommend the sausage and onion marmalade sandwich, which is served on seasonal bread. The experience was very positive and relaxed and I will definitely be returning soon.
